        It was the best decision he ever made, since then he has wins over Kotelnik, Malignaggi, Maidana, Judah, that is nothing to s****** it, in my personal opinion he also beat Peterson, but I accept it could have gone either way, he has a couple of Foty candidates in there, so he has been entertaining for the fans. He has also made a lot of money in that time but I don't think that is the only reason he is in the game. He was wealthy from early on in his pro career, yet he has shown incredible heart and aptitude for taking punishment, even in the losses he was still trying to carry on after knock downs.

        To be honest I think your theory is unfounded and is based on little to no facts. His career is indeed at a crossroads right now, but he has had a good career thus far so let's see if he can bounce back.

        I'm sure if he was only in it for the money he would have stayed at home and carried on fighting in the UK, he may not have made quite the same amount of money per fight, but he would have certainly made 7 figure pay days whilst taking an easier path.
